The Development Journey
Assess. Understand.Connect. Develop.
Athletes complete approved assessments, understand their development priorities, connect with relevant qualified experts and track progress over time through GESI AthleteOS.
- 01
Assess
Athletes complete approved GESI sports science assessments appropriate to age and stage.
- 02
Understand
Results are translated into clear development priorities the athlete and family can act on.
- 03
Connect
AthleteOS surfaces qualified experts matched to sport, position, age and priorities.
- 04
Develop
Work is tracked over time inside AthleteOS so progress — not promises — guides the next cycle.

How Training Happens
In Person, Virtual or Hybrid.
In Person
On-site sessions at schools, clubs and partner facilities where a qualified expert is available locally.
Virtual
Remote sessions for technique review, programming and education when distance or cost is a barrier.
Hybrid
A combination of periodic in-person work with ongoing virtual support between sessions.

Not Just a Trainer Directory
Qualified Expertise. Trusted Standards.
Qualified
Relevant certifications, qualifications and demonstrated expertise.
Vetted
Identity, professional history and appropriate background screening.
Safe
Safeguarding standards and appropriate athlete protections.
Accountable
GESI professional standards, privacy requirements and ongoing review.
GESI expert partner trainers provide additional specialized capacity. They supplement school coaches and athletic programs — they do not replace them, and they take no part in team selection or playing-time decisions.
